Question by shar212000: Good treatment for women hair loss?
I’ve been experiencing hair loss and I wondered if any women out there have bought any hair loss product out there (in store or online) that they felt work for them. Any suggestions? Thanks!

Best answer:

Answer by Jodi Traxler
The reason for your hair loss can be due to many different factors. The treatment will depend entirely on what is causing your loss. It could be your diet, menopause, improper hair care, stress… and the list goes on. You must determine the cause of Your hair fall, to find the treatment that is right for you.
